The Role:

Working within our Housing and Public Protection Team you will be responsible for carrying out HHSRS inspections in both single and multi-occupancy dwellings.

You will be responsible for:

Responding to service requests, investigating complaints across the range of private sector housing including mobile homes and unauthorised encampments. Taking the appropriate enforcement action to bring both single dwellings and HMOs up to standard and actively seek out unlicenced HMOs.
